These are ordinary Orando fantail goldfish, and they will spawn under the right (controlled) conditions and depending on the size of the adults..... they will deliver anything from 1,000 to around 4,000 eggs (per week).... Do not even attempt to breed them if you do not have a lot of space to rear the fry...... (eggs will hatch and be free swimming in about 3 to 4 days - depending on the water temperature)

however the fist fish is a goldfish and will not, and can not, breed with a gourami (the second fish). they should also not be kept in the same tank as goldfish are coldwater pond fish that grow to a rediculus size and the gourami is tropical so it needs a warmer tank.
